      What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
      - Manage the Houston Endowment supported adult education project, including participant recruitment and project goals
      - Build and maintain relationships with community partners and service providers in the adult education and civics space
      - Plan and execute community partner events and adult education classes to achieve grant goals
      - Collaborate with internal teams to connect grant partners with YES Prep's schools and support fundraising efforts
      - Publicize grant successes to stakeholders and governmental offices to maximize impact

      What is Required (Qualifications):
      - Bachelor's degree from an accredited four-year institution or equivalent experience
      - Minimum of 2 years of relevant experience in community organizing, advocacy, or nonprofit service provision
      - Bilingual in Spanish
      - Ability to work outside of normal hours and on weekends
      -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to maintain positive working relationships in a collaborative environment

      How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
      - Advanced degree from an accredited educational institution
      - Active involvement in local civic clubs, volunteer organizations, or community associations
      - Experience as a YES Prep parent, alumni, or teacher
      - Proficiency in multiple languages, with Spanish preferred
